This weekend (Friday evening / Saturday morning) was an important time in our on-going revitalization efforts. The SBCV’s Darrell Webb acted as consultant and facilitator in this collaborative workshop.

Leading up to the weekend, we prayed for ten minutes each day for twenty days, for unity of heart and for ideas to reach our community that match the heart of God.

During the weekend, we reviewed results of the survey everyone took back in June. Team leads presented demographics in our local area and lead discussions in three areas regarding our future: missions and outreach, partnering, and thinking big. After discussion and putting forth ideas, we prayed over everything that we discussed, asking God to lead us in His way.
